Output 8b404f343f2bbfe73229c8403174a204fbe4b4990474cad911225c318f616213:1

value
1540704
script pubkey
OP_0 OP_PUSHBYTES_20 d1f0fd2c37ca057410d50ac114f5dc861cc0901e
address
bc1q68c06tphegzhgyx4ptq3fawuscwvpyq7ezalrm
transaction
8b404f343f2bbfe73229c8403174a204fbe4b4990474cad911225c318f616213
confirmations
309250
spent
true